Given:
Side length of square = 2 in
To find:
The area of the square
Solution:
Area of the square:
Area = side × side
= 2 in × 2 in
Area = 4 in²
Therefore, the area of the square is 4 inches².
Answer:
12c + 14d - 4
Step-by-step explanation:
16d + 20c + 5d -7 - 8c - 7d + 3
Simplify the expression
__________________________
To solve, we need to first take in mind the fact that there are different like terms within this expression. Like terms are numbers or values that end in different symbols, such as variables or exponents. Since we are filled with variables such as c and d. We can do as followed :
Combine the "d" like terms :
16d + 5d - 7d
21d - 7d
14d
Combine the "c" like terms :
20c - 8c
12c
Combine the constants :
-7 + 3
-4
Now add all of the values together to get the final expression.
12c + 14d - 4
